Transaction 57f729f42007836943e50b60cdbf1ab653e70157ca69c16d33fca1b402012221
1 Input
1 Output
-
57f729f42007836943e50b60cdbf1ab653e70157ca69c16d33fca1b402012221:0
- value
- 2496685
- script pubkey
- OP_0 OP_PUSHBYTES_20 be2f92136b313fe33c33d64c8f12de87e3fae5ca
- address
- bc1qhcheyymtxyl7x0pn6exg7yk7sl3l4ew2j8uucz